Clinical definition (Orphanet)

A rare, high-grade, malignant glial tumor, histologically characterized by abundance of pleomorphic astrocytes and multiple mitotic figures, often associated with diffuse infiltration of the surrounding tissue, considerable edema and mass effect and involvement of the contralateral brain. Depending on the primary localization of the tumor, patients can present with signs of raised intracranial pressure (headache, vomiting, papilledema), , neurological deficits, and/or behavioral changes. The tumor is most commonly localized in the frontal and temporal lobes, brain stem and spinal cord.

How rare: 1-9 / 1 000 000 — roughly one to nine people per million. In a city the size of Kolkata, perhaps a few dozen.

Observational and natural-history studies

17 observational studies match this condition. These do not test a treatment and are not counted in the interventional-trial headline, but they are genuine research: natural-history work often defines the endpoints needed for a future rare-disease trial, and families may be able to enroll.
